Hi Sandra, some of the answers may be the same as before, some may be different. I will try to keep my sense of humour out of this and answer as concisely as possible.
1, No. If there is not now, there never was. I will elaborate if you like.
2. The illusion of a separate self is exactly that; an illusion. There is no memory of being very young without one, but I presume we are born without one. It must be gained from environmental influences; our parents and those around us. Mum must keep saying "Shannon, Shannon..." then there must be the thought; "Oh, that's me" Then it all starts: "This feels nice, if I do this I will get more. This feels nasty, what can I do to avoid this... etc. Until a whole story of who I am and what I want, and what I don't want is built up, and called "me". With this "me" comes "mine" and "you" and "yours". Then you have to start defending what's "mine" and getting what you want from "you", and the whole bloody mess gains momentum and is totally believed in! How I see it now looks bloody hilarious! (whops, sense of humour!) But it's true, it just looks ridiculous! That is describing it as I see it now. This belief causes a heap of suffering, and I guess that's not so funny. I'm just glad to be out of it.
3. There is a stillness underneath/behind everything, this is unchanging. There have been many "effects" experienced, some quite wonderful, but the real difference is knowing that all that stuff which I took so seriously "my life" is not real at all. This is liberating. This is liberation.
4. There have been several moments which have made the seeing complete. The one I wrote about last week: Looking, looking, looking for something that I know doe's not exist is a frustrating and pointless exercise. Through this realisation I saw that I knew already. The other was a quite unexplainable occurrence yesterday, when there was a sharp pain in my head, then total clarity. The clarity has not diminished.
5. No, "decisions" just happen, even if they are very calculated. Like weather to paraglide or not, there are many factors taken into consideration for safety etc, then the decision "no" just arrives. Someone said the other day "from your subconscious", I had a good look, and I don't seem to have a subconscious! Anyway I wrote a whole load about this the other day with examples, and the same conclusion was arrived at: No.
6. I am happy to go on with the enquiery with you Sandra, I presume that doubts/unclarity will arise. (Again, I am struck by how you are just words that appear on a screen, but thank you so much). The looking continues, but the search is over. Much love.
